At the same time, when the Middle East Alliance government complained with grief and anger about the cold-bloodedness and tyranny of Armadanai, when personnel from the Star Group fully settled in Mehran and began to "investigate" the causes and consequences of the entire nuclear explosion.

As the "chief culprits", Ames and Goodman took a transport plane from Elysium to Armadane's headquarters on the circular space station early to accept questions from the board of directors.

Through the thick one-way glass, the interrogator personally appointed by the company's board of directors could clearly see that Norn Goodman, who had been stripped of all his positions and titles, was sitting on the regret chair with a fur cushion specially added for him. The high-spiritedness he once had was completely gone, and his face was full of decadence and unwillingness.

The interrogator turned his head and looked at his left and right sides. They were representatives from the North American Alliance and the National Cooperation Bureau - they would supervise the entire interrogation process and ensure that Armadyne would not do anything to let the criminal escape his responsibility. punishment.

However, it is easy to tell from the absent-minded looks on their faces that they have gone through this process more than once.

"Ahem, Norn Goodman, can you hear me?"

After confirming that there were no problems with the supervisors, the interrogator put his mouth to the microphone and said slowly: "This is the fifth three-party interrogation of you. It can be seen that you still don't want to cooperate with our work. If this continues, it will be harmful to everyone." No good."

Goodman was unmoved, just sitting in his chair and staring coldly at the one-way glass. Although he knew that his face would not be seen and that after several days of questioning, he was familiar with this look, the interrogator still felt a chill in his heart.

The questioner knows that if he continues to delay like this, not only will he be unable to complete the tasks assigned to him by the board of directors, but the company will also lose the trust of customers every second.

In just a few words, several raw material suppliers or buyers may have announced unilateral termination of contracts with the company, causing the company to lose hundreds of millions of American dollars.

So the interrogator decided to give Goodman something strong.

I saw him ordering a red-painted Zoey special for the Elysian Space to pick up the tray that had been prepared long ago, open the door of the room, and place the tray in front of Goodman.

Under his surprised gaze, the robot opened the electronic shackles on Goodman's wrists, allowing him to move his hands and see for himself what was in the tray in front of him.

A dinner plate covered with a thermal cover and a paper document.

Goodman thought for a few seconds before choosing to look at the file rather than enjoy his lunch. While he was frowning and carefully reading the information on the document, the interrogator also explained it to him through the glass.

"Just this morning, the settlement negotiations between the company and the Middle East Alliance ended in complete failure. And with the support and guarantee of the Stars Group, the Middle East Alliance decided to prosecute you, Ames Singer and others for war crimes at the International Court of Justice in The Hague. The whole company.”

"Hmm, war crime."

Goodman finally had some reaction when he heard this term. After repeating this avoidable term in a hoarse voice, he suddenly laughed.

"Hahaha, so the company doesn't intend to believe Ames and I. The questioning that has been playing house for so many days is actually just forcing me to confess. It is not looking for the truth of the matter at all."

The old man in front of him showed no regrets, and the interrogator also became angry.

Gu only saw him punch the table with his fist and said in a decisive tone: "If you think that the huge crater created by the nuclear explosion in the center of Mehran has nothing to do with you, I don't mind hearing what you have to say. the truth."

"That's all, it seems that we are all being played by that cunning guy."

After reading one page carefully, Goodman began to quickly browse the entire document - the dozens of pages of documents contained not only the company's expert team's review and speculation on the Mehran incident, but also The Middle East Alliance and the Stars Group made almost all moves in just one week.

Goodman touched the stubble on his chin that had not grown for a week and said self-deprecatingly: "In the face of the established facts, any so-called strong evidence or excuse is just a lie."

"You're right. Facing the huge crater created by the nuclear bomb, no matter how we explain it, it's impossible to clear ourselves of the crime."

He closed the document, stood it upright, and knocked it so that the papers that had been messed up by him could return to their original positions. Then Goodman gently placed the folder on the edge of the dinner plate, where it started.

"Unless you are willing to continue to increase the number according to other people's rhythm, open the central database, and reveal all the company's secrets to the world. This can indeed prove that the nuclear bomb was not made by us, but it is estimated that the company's crime will not be a war crime by then. It’s easy to solve.”

The interrogator saw that the old man's thoughts on the other side of the glass had not become confused due to a week of house arrest, but were actually very clear. If you look at the supervisors around you who are pretending to be distracted or whispering, you know that not only do they not have any doubts about Goodman's dangerous remarks, but they will try every means to conceal the content of the conversation for the company.

Nodding with satisfaction, the interrogator knew that the company's billions of dollars in "clearance expenses" every year were not in vain, so he decided to strike while the iron was hot and coerce and induce Goodman.

"Mr. Goodman, although I know that this is a bit difficult, the company's board of directors hopes that you will accept this ending that should not be like this. As long as you are willing to read a few lines prepared in advance in the Hague court as planned, I guarantee your personality, The company will equip you with the best team of lawyers and will never let you suffer any injustice or injustice.”

"After all, very few civilians were affected by the nuclear explosion. They were basically thugs from the anti-humanity organization Renaissance Front. I believe the judges will also take this into consideration during the trial."

Goodman smiled when he heard this and asked: "What about that old guy from Eames? Will he sit on the witness stand and testify against me?"

Feeling that the interrogation that lasted for a week finally made some progress, the interrogator couldn't wait to explain: "If nothing else happens, Mr. Singer will live in seclusion in the Elysian Space in the next one to two years, trying to reduce his sense of existence in order to redeem himself. Something about his public image.”

"So, you don't have to worry about the board of directors abandoning the car to keep the coach. As long as there is a glimmer of hope, we will not abandon any high-value personnel like you."

"It's almost done..."

Silently mocking the brazen interrogator in his mind, Goodman calmly opened the heat-insulating cover on the dinner plate to see what delicious food was on the plate.

A plump, juicy chargrilled turkey leg.

The moment he opened the cover, the sweet fruity aroma suddenly emerged from under the attractively colored skin and penetrated Goodman's nose.

"Well, apples, oranges and lemons, with some honey."

He raised his knife and fork to cut off a small piece of chicken leg meat and put it into his mouth. Goodman exhaled a breath of contentment - this was one of the few delicacies he had eaten since being under house arrest.

"Has it been a week already?"

Goodman, who just realized that today is Christmas, ate the turkey legs in small bites and missed Christmases in the past. Entertain celebrities from all over the world in a luxurious villa, and spend long nights by the fireside with many people who share the same hobbies and tastes as you.

Unfortunately, he now has neither a villa nor a fireplace.

"After you finish your meal, someone will take you back to Earth to wait for the court in The Hague."

"As for now, please enjoy it slowly."

As the lights in the cubicle where the interrogator and others were located were extinguished, only the sound of knives and forks cutting turkey legs could still be heard clearly in the huge interrogation room.
